13.07.2015 Views

PESQUISA OPERACIONAL - Unesp

PESQUISA OPERACIONAL - Unesp

PESQUISA OPERACIONAL - Unesp

SHOW MORE
SHOW LESS

Create successful ePaper yourself

Turn your PDF publications into a flip-book with our unique Google optimized e-Paper software.

72Capítulo 77. DESENVOLVIMENTO E OTIMIZAÇÃO DE MODELOS DE OTIMIZAÇÃO COMBINATÓRIANeste tópico vamos comentar sobre problemas de dificuldade polinomial (P) e problemas dedificuldade não polinomiais (NP).Problemas polinomiais são problemas cujos algoritmos conhecidos fornecem soluções quepodem ser obtidas por meio de uma função polinomial de n tamanho de entrada, ou seja: f (n) =O(n k ) sendo que(k) uma constante. Problemas NP são problemas cujos algoritmos de soluçãoconhecidos são baseados em enumeração, seja ela implícita ou não. De maneira geral, o númerode combinações possíveis é assustadoramente grande, fazendo com que os algoritmosenumerativos não consigam resolver problemas com grande número de entradas em tempohábil. São denominados algoritmos de tempo exponencial e, é nestes contextos que se encaixamos problemas de otimização combinatória. Os problemas NP podem ser classificado, conforme(COLIN, 2007): Problemas NP - Completos: são problemas que possuem uma forte evidência da nãoexistência de um algoritmo cujo tempo de solução seja uma função polinomial dotamanho da entrada. São considerados os mais difíceis da classe NP, e, se algum deles forresolvido em tempo polinomial, então todos os problemas NP também serão.Quando se sabe que um problema de otimização é NP - difícil, tem-se a certeza de que nemsempre a solução ótima será encontrada. Portanto, tem se aplicado métodos heurísticos, comopor exemplo, algoritmos genéticos, colônias de formigas, busca tabu, dentre outras. Abaixoencontra-se o modelo do problema do Caixeiro-Viajante (CV), sendo este modelo de otimizaçãocombinatória.

Hooray! Your file is uploaded and ready to be published.

Saved successfully!

Ooh no, something went wrong!